Set.prototype.values()

values() method는 Set 객체에 요소가 삽입된 순서대로 각 요소의 값을 순환할 수 있는 새로운 Iterator 객체를 반환합니다.

참고: keys() 메소드는 이 메소드의 별칭입니다(Map 객체와 유사성을 위해). 따라서, key() 페이지는 이곳으로 리다이렉트 됩니다. 그것은 정확히 동일하게 작동하며 Set 요소의 을 반환합니다.

시도해보기

구문

js

values();

반환 값

주어진 Set의 각 요소의 값을 삽입 순서대로 포함하는 새로운 iterator 객체

예시

values() 사용하기

js

var mySet = new Set();
mySet.add("foo");
mySet.add("bar");
mySet.add("baz");
var setIter = mySet.values();
console.log(setIter.next().value); // "foo"
console.log(setIter.next().value); // "bar"
console.log(setIter.next().value); // "baz"

명세

Specification
ECMAScript Language Specification
# sec-set.prototype.values

브라우저 호환성

BCD tables only load in the browser

같이 보기